繁体   English   中英

Android Studio-推荐的图像处理库,可与Android Studio完美配合

[英]Android Studio - Advisable Image Processing Library that works well with Android Studio

我觉得有必要提出这个问题,因为Android开发已从Eclipse迁移到Android Studio。 除了用于Eclipse的旧.jar文件库外,大量的库(例如,用于Android的AChartEngine,以及用于Android的其他图形库)还使其库可用于Maven Dependencies。

但是,图像处理库的情况并不相同,因为它们中的大多数仍在使用jar,因此当您需要将其导入Android Studio时会有些麻烦。

一个著名的用于图像处理的开源库是OpenCV。 由于一些Stack Overflow的答案,我设法将其导入到Android Studio项目中。 但是,似乎静态初始化适用于Android Studio的OpenCV并不是那么简单。 另外,OpenCV到Android Studio的导入指南似乎已“过时”,因为其中一些人要求在Android Studio中的“ app”文件夹下创建一个文件夹,但我似乎做不到。 情况很简单,OpenCV需要大量工作才能导入Android Studio。 另一个问题是,似乎缺少有关如何在Android中使用OpenCV开发应用程序的教程/指南。

我发现的另一个库是AndroidFastImageProcessing。 这是Android中可用的另一个图像处理库,但是由于需要Android Support Repository (我只有支持库)而无法使用Android Support Repository ,因此无法将其导入Android Studio。 由于无法正确导入图像处理库,我的进度再次受到阻碍。

现在,我可能在导入时做错了-因此,如果有将OpenCV导入Android Studio的新方法和更新方法,请将其放入答案中,我将不胜感激。 AndroidFastImageProcessing也是如此-如果有一种方法可以在Android Studio中成功将其导入,我很想知道。

我的主要问题是:是否有可以轻松导入Android Studio的图像处理库? 教程/出色的文档将加分。

有许多可用于android的本机图像处理库,但是问题是缺少示例和教程,但是您当然可以找到许多库:

几个最常用的列表:1. AndroidJniBitmapOperations 2. javacv 3. Opencv

如果您想在NDK上工作https://github.com/julienr/libpng-android

到目前为止,最好的是JAVACV-一个用于本机opancv的Java包装器,它发展得很好,并且几乎没有有用的教程和大量文档,您可以像我一样在javacv中开始图像处理;)

https://github.com/bytedeco/javacv

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M